    Police: Americans arrested after brawl at Cruise Port; fighting continued at police station | News


    Five cruise ship passengers were arrested at Nassau Cruise Port after they got into a fight on Monday, police said.

    But the fighting did not stop there.

    Police said the Americans, three women and two men, then started a brawl at the police station near the cruise port, which left three officers injured and the station in disarray.

    The incident started at 4:45 p.m., police said.

    Police responded to reports of a fight at the cruise port.

    “Officers responded, and with the assistance of additional personnel, intervened and took three females and two males into custody,” police said.

    “The complainant was subsequently invited to the police station to provide an official statement. Upon arrival at the station, officers prepared to search the arrested individuals.

    “During the process, a violent struggle reportedly ensued between officers and the five suspects.

    “One female suspect allegedly threw a chair through a southern glass door, causing it to shatter. A male suspect then allegedly kicked out the remaining glass and attempted to escape, but was immediately subdued by officers. Additional police units were requested to assist in restoring order.

    “The five suspects sustained minor injuries during the initial altercation at the Cruise Port and were examined and treated by Emergency Medical Services personnel. As a result of the confrontation at the police station, several officers’ uniforms were damaged and four officers sustained various injuries.

    “Two officers were reportedly struck about the body, while another suffered a laceration to the mouth. The fourth officer sustained a serious injury to his left shoulder and was transported to the hospital by ambulance for medical treatment.”

    The five Americans were detained in relation to five offenses: assaulting a police officer; fighting in a public space; resisting arrest; malicious damage; and disorderly behavior in a police station.
